Explain why magnesium hydroxide has the formula Mg(OH)2

This is because magnesium has a 2+ charge whereas hydroxide has a 1- charge so you'd need 2 hydroxides to balance out the charges

Mg2+ OH-
OH-

2+. 2-

So Mg(OH)2. 2 hydroxide molecules and one magnesium

A reactant or is being consumed in a first-order reaction. what fraction of the initial r is consumed in 4.0 half-lives
zhannawk [14.2K]
Answer : If a reactant undergoes first order kinetics and the initial reactant was R is consumed in 4 half lives then,

the first half life would undergo from 1 to 1/2R; 

the second half life will go from 1/2R to 1/4R;

in third half life it will undergo from 1/4R to 1/8R;

And finally in fourth half life it will go from 1/8R to 1/16R.

So, it means 15/16^{th} is utilized and only 1/16 R remains
